ES-301 Control Room/In-Plant Systems Outline Form ES-301-2 Facility: Byron Nuclear Station Date of Examination: 9/27/21 Exam Level: RO SRO-I SRO-U Operating Test Number: 2021-301 Control Room Systems:* 8 for RO, 7 for SRO-I, and 2 or 3 for SRO-U System/JPM Title Type Code* Safety Function

a. Perform a 50 Gallon Boration of the RCS (MODE 1), (Boration S, A, M 1 fails to stop) 004A4.12 Ability to manually operate and/or monitor in the control room: Boration /dilution batch control Modified from JPM Bank 3.8/3.3 2012 NRC Exam (Modified)
b. Raise Accumulator Level with the A SI pp S, A, D, EN 2 006A1.13Ability to predict and/or monitor changes in parameters (to prevent exceeding design limits) associated with operating the ECCS controls including: Accumulator pressure (level, boron concentration)

JPM Bank 3.5/3.7

c. Align ECCS to Cold Leg (1Component Cooling Pump Available) S, A, L, D, EN 3 011EA1.11 Ability to operate and monitor the following as they apply to a Large Break LOCA: Long-term cooling of core JPM Bank 4.2/4.2
d. Restore FW per Attachment C of 1BEP ES-0.1 S, D, L 4S 059A4.11 Ability to manually operate and monitor in the control room: Recovery from automatic feedwater isolation JPM Bank 3.1/3.2
e. SX Flooding Requiring RCFC Isolation (Running Train Leak) S, D, A 5 022A2.05 Ability to (a) predict the impacts of the following malfunctions or operations on the CCS; and (b) based on the predictions, use procedures to correct, control, or mitigate the consequences of those malfunctions or operations: Major leak in CCS JPM Bank 3.1/3.5
f. Synchronize a D/G to a Bus and Load to 1000 KW S, D, EN 6 064A4.06 Ability to manually operate and/or monitor in the control room: Manual start, loading, and stopping of the ED/G JPM Bank 3.9/3.9 2012 NRC Exam

ES-301 Control Room/In-Plant Systems Outline Form ES-301-2

g. Respond to RCP Thermal Barrier Leak with CC Valve Failure S, A, D 4P 003A4.08, Ability to manually operate and/or monitor in the control room: RCP cooling water supplies JPM Bank 3.2/2.9
h. Perform RMS Functional Test in Preparation for Waste Gas S, D 9 Release 071A4.25 Ability to manually operate and/or monitor in the control room: Setting of process radiation monitor alarms, automatic functions, and adjustment of setpoints JPM Bank 3.2/3.2 In-Plant Systems:* 3 for RO, 3 for SRO-I, and 3 or 2 for SRO-U
i. Locally close 2AF005 valves B Train N, R, E 4S 2.1.30 Ability to locate and operate components, including local controls.

New 4.4/4.0

j. Bus Duct Response N, E 6 062A2.01 Ability to (a) predict the impacts of the following malfunctions or operations on the ac distribution system; and (b) based on those predictions use procedures to correct, control, or mitigate the consequences of those malfunctions or operations:

Types of loads that, if de-energized, would degrade or hinder plant operation New 3.4/3.9

k. Operate the Fire Detection/Alarm Equipment (without control A, D 8 power) 086A2.04 Ability to (a) predict the impacts of the following malfunctions or operations on the Fire Protection System; and (b) based on those predictions, use procedures to correct, control, or mitigate the consequences of those malfunctions or operations:

Failure to actuate the FPS when required, resulting in fire damage.

JPM Bank 3.3/3.9

  • All RO and SRO-I control room (and in-plant) systems must be different and serve different safety functions, all five SRO-U systems must serve different safety functions, and in-plant systems and functions may overlap those tested in the control room.

ES-301 Control Room/In-Plant Systems Outline Form ES-301-2

  • Type Codes Criteria for RO /SRO-I/SRO-U (A)lternate path 4-6/4-6 /2-3 (6)

(C)ontrol room (D)irect from bank 9/ 8/ 4 (8)

(E)mergency or abnormal in-plant 1/ 1/ 1 (2)

(EN)gineered safety feature 1/ 1/ 1 (control room system) (3)

(L)ow-Power/Shutdown 1/ 1/ 1 (2)

(N)ew or (M)odified from bank including 1(A) 2/ 2/ 1 (3, 1A)

(P)revious 2 exams 3/ 3/ 2 (randomly selected) (0)

(R)CA 1/ 1/ 1 (1)

(S)imulator (8)
